#65714b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#65714b is composed of 39.6% red, 44.3% green and 29.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.6%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 78.9 degrees, a saturation of 20.2% and a lightness of 36.9%. #65714b color hex could be obtained by blending #cae296 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#65714b color description : Very dark grayish green.
#65714b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#65714b has RGB values of R:101, G:113, B:75 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0, Y:0.34,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 6648139.
